On October 31, Malacañang released the list of regular and special non-working holidays for next year.
Here’s the full list of the 2025 Philippine holidays:
Regular holidays:
- New Year’s Day – January 1 (Wednesday)
- Araw ng Kagitingan – April 9 (Wednesday)
- Maundy Thursday – April 17
- Good Friday – April 18
- Labor Day – May 1 (Thursday)
- Independence Day – June 12 (Thursday)
- National Heroes Day – August 25 (Last Monday of August)
- Bonifacio Day – November 30 (Sunday)
- Christmas Day – December 25 (Thursday)
- Rizal Day – December 30 (Tuesday)
Special non-working days:
- Ninoy Aquino Day – August 21 (Thursday)
- All Saints Day – November 1 (Saturday)
- Feast of the Immaculate Conception of Mary – December 8 (Monday)
- Last Day of the Year – December 31 (Wednesday)
Special working day:
- EDSA People Power Revolution Anniversary – February 25 (Tuesday)
Additional special non-working days:
- Chinese New Year – January 29 (Wednesday)
- Founding anniversary of Iglesia ni Cristo – July 27 (Sunday)
- Black Saturday – April 19
- Christmas Eve – December 24 (Wednesday)
- All Saints’ Day Eve – October 31 (Friday)
